Considered one of the most important abstract artists in Catalonia in the 1950’s, Joan Vilacasas (Sabadell, 1920 – Barcelona, 2007) was a multi-faceted artist who produced paintings on a variety of supports, such as cloth and polystyrene, as well as ceramics, sculptural structures and literature. His output reached its highpoint in the 1950’s with his planimetrías – spatial structures based on lineal networks and rhythms over topographical backgrounds, which brought him wider recognition. Now the Fundació Vila Casas is paying tribute with a retrospective showing the different periods his output covered.
